pandoc-citeproc-preamble - 1.7-2 main

pandoc-citeproc-preamble is a JSON filter for Pandoc which inserts a preamble
before the output that Pandoc's citeproc filter appends to the document. This
preamble might include a heading (e.g. "Bibliography") and raw markup to
format the bibliography for the output format.
.
Since Pandoc's citeproc filter doesn't provide any facility to add formatting
control code to its output, pandoc-citeproc-preamble is necessary to avoid
the user being forced to add their control code to the end of their input
files, thereby losing the input file's agnosticity with regard to output
format.
